JOB SUMMARY
The Laundry Attendant is responsible for ensuring a consistent supply of clean, well-presented linens and robes to support daily spa operations. Primary responsibilities include all laundry-related tasks including the transportation of linens to and from the main hotel laundry, steaming and preparing robes, organizing clean inventory, and maintaining strict sanitation and presentation standards. Secondary responsibilities include providing guests with professional and comprehensive assistance throughout their spa visit, helping to exceed guest expectations, while maintaining a clean and welcoming environment in the spa, locker rooms, and reception area. Effectively communicates with guests to understand their needs and address any concerns while consistently upholding high customer service standards.
